Passmark

This is the most ubiquitous GPU benchmark. It gives the graphics card a thorough evaluation under various types of load, providing four separate benchmarks for Direct3D versions 9, 10, 11 and 12 (the last being done in 4K resolution if possible), and few more tests engaging DirectCompute capabilities.

Pros & cons summary


Performance score 5.49 41.36
Recency 23 July 2013 8 January 2024
Maximum RAM amount 4 GB 16 GB
Chip lithography 28 nm 6 nm
Power consumption (TDP) 75 Watt 190 Watt

K3100M has 153% lower power consumption.

RX 7600 XT, on the other hand, has a 653% higher aggregate performance score, an age advantage of 10 years, a 300% higher maximum VRAM amount, and a 367% more advanced lithography process.

The Radeon RX 7600 XT is our recommended choice as it beats the Quadro K3100M in performance tests.

Be aware that Quadro K3100M is a mobile workstation graphics card while Radeon RX 7600 XT is a desktop one.
